Work on hydrating yourself in the lead up to the fast. THat doens' tmean downing gallons of water on friday. It means making sure you eat well, and drink a LOT the entire week, so that your body is truly hydrated.

Also remind yourself that most people can fast a lot longer than 25 hours with no serious consequences.
